Beautiful blade! Always thought it was interesting that the traditional Japanese method of joining the handle to the blade was by placing the hole in the blade slightly further forward than the hole in the handle. It forces the handle material forward when not using epoxy.

Just for clarification... I’ve worked with wood my entire life for the forestry commission etc looking after woodland all over the uk 🇬🇧... where did you acquire the bog oak... because to my trained eye that looks like torrified oak not bog oak... they cook the wood at higher temperatures to give it this colour and take all the moisture oak... bog oak generally hardly shows the grain and the mottled look of your piece of wood suggests to me torrification
